Moonlight State Beach

Moonlight Beach has big, sandy and popular. Has all kinds of usual beach amenities such as restrooms, food (in summer), fire pits, beach gear rentals and a playground. Besides the sandy beach, their are tidepools. Located at the end of Encinitas Blvd. on B Street. Good beach for little kids and people with mobility problems. Volleyball, barbecues, firepits....

Beacons Beach

Part of Leucadia State Beach. Sandy, with cliffs. No restrooms. Located at Neptune Avenue.

Cardiff State Beach- directly across from Cardiff Beach House South!

Surfing and wind surfing. Lots of sand plus tide pools at the southern end. Across the street is the San Elijo Lagoon, which has trails and birdwatching. Good beach for little kids and people with mobility problems

San Elijo State Beach- Really close to Cardiff Beach House South!

This beach has a campground with 171 sites on the high bluff. The beach has lots of tide pools. For camping info, call 760-753-5091.
